Bookroo's summary

Journey through nature's numerical wonders, from pairs of bird wings to the infinite stars above. This vibrant counting book invites young readers to discover the beauty of numbers in the natural world, with playful rhymes and vivid illustrations. Can you imagine the countless stars in the sky?

From the publisher

Discover nature by the numbers in this gorgeous, innovative counting book.

The natural world is full of sets of numbers: from birds’ wings in twos and clover leaves in threes to deer hooves in fours and octopus arms in eights. This book uses playful rhyming text to explore these numerical sets in vibrant detail, ending with the stars in the sky—a number set too big to count!

Stories behind the story

Were there any pivotal changes that your story/illustrations underwent throughout the writing/editing process?

When I first wrote this, there were nine planets--then they took Pluto away! It took me two more years to find the nine-spined stickleback fish. By Nancy Raines Day (author)

What part of creating What in the World? did you most enjoy?

Seeing what Kurt Cyrus did with my text! The way he brought all these different elements together with a sense of flow and tender beauty blew me away. By Nancy Raines Day (author)
